Ring Flight is a classic in magic that combines a borrowed object to an impossible location with the emotional hook of the object itself. Ring In The Bell is an astonishing ring flight with a sure-fire method that allows you to vanish a spectator’s ring and make it re-appear on the clapper of the bell they are holding.

In this volume, Ross Bertram, noted Canadian magician, gambling authority, and coin magic expert, gives magicians the best of his many years of performing experience. It includes over 400 photos to explicitly portray every detail of the text.
